CFX-Post: uniformly zero gradient of non constant variable
 
Dear all,

I am trying to compute the gradient of a newly created variable. But this gradient is zero every where even though the original variable in not constant.
For example I can obtain the gradient of the static pressure without any problem. But it I create a Mach number variable, its gradient come to be zero everywhere.
I tried a small verification: even when I create a variable var to be var=Static Pressure, the var.Gradient is uniformly zero while Static Pressure.Gradient is not.

Can someone explain me what is going wrong?
And how I can obtain the gradient of newly created variables?
